Bug description:
  After completing a fresh install, the grub.cfg on the target system
  uses the device name as the root= kernel parameter instead of the
  UUID, causing the system to fail to boot if the devices are enumerated
  differently.  Running update-grub on the target system regenerates the
  config file correctly using the UUID.
